Electromagnetic Warfare (EW) is ubiquitous in all modern-day military conflicts. MBDA is developing products that will enable the UK Services (and the UK’s allies) to continue to obtain battlefield information superiority and robust situational awareness, whilst also being able to sufficiently disrupt / deny / degrade enemy operations. Our EW Group supports activities on all relevant WS and missile programmes, with specific responsibilities for the physical integration and functional operation of RF Electronic Support / Attack payloads as part of the wider EW effects chain at Missile, Weapon System and System of Systems levels.The RF Systems Team within the EW Group has a vacancy for an Equipment Requirement Authority (ERA). The role is within an exciting project which is at the forefront of a new and growing domain, and you will have the opportunity to own and steer the development of the product. The ERA will work with the wider organisation and industrial partners to ensure delivery of the configured hardware and validation evidence whilst ensuring time, cost and quality constraints are adhered to. Reporting directly to a Design Lead or Chief Design Engineer, you will be responsible for managing the development of your equipment’s requirements, ensuring suitable flow down into the supply chain (internal or external), specifying and collecting technical evidence through testing or analysis, and ensuring safe and secure integrity is maintained throughout the development cycle and into the hands of our Customers.To be successful in this role, you will need to have a broad understanding of the engineering design process, as well as an appreciation for good requirement specification practices.
